About The Position

Supervises the Prior Authorization, Concurrent Review, and/or Retrospective Review Clinical Review team to ensure appropriate care to members. This role supervises the day-to-day activities of the utilization management team, monitors and tracks UM resources to ensure adherence to performance, compliance, quality, and efficiency standards. The position collaborates with the utilization management team to resolve complex care member issues, maintains knowledge of regulations, accreditation standards, and industry best practices related to utilization management, and works with the utilization management team and senior management to identify opportunities for process and quality improvements within utilization management. Additionally, the role educates and provides resources for the utilization management team on key initiatives and to facilitate on-going communication between the utilization management team, members, and providers. The supervisor monitors prior authorization, concurrent review, and/or retrospective clinical review nurses and ensures compliance with applicable guidelines, policies, and procedures. They work with senior management to develop and implement UM policies, procedures, and guidelines that ensure appropriate and effective utilization of healthcare services. Performance evaluation, coaching, guidance, and assistance with onboarding, hiring, and training are also key aspects of this role. The supervisor leads and champions change within their scope of responsibility and performs other duties as assigned, while complying with all policies and standards.
